How to Fill Out Chess: An Introductory Course
01
Start with the basics: Begin by learning the rules and fundamentals of chess. Understand how each piece moves, the objective of the game, and the various techniques involved.
02
Study chess notation: Familiarize yourself with the algebraic notation system used in chess. This will allow you to record and read chess moves, which is essential for analyzing games and studying strategies.
03
Learn about openings: Explore different chess openings and understand their purpose. Gain knowledge about the principles of opening play, such as controlling the center, developing pieces, and safeguarding the king.
04
Understand middle game strategies: Dive into the middle game, where the majority of tactical battles occur. Learn about concepts like piece activity, pawn structure, attacking strategies, and positional understanding.
05
Analyze endgame techniques: Develop proficiency in endgame play, which focuses on converting material advantages into checkmate. Learn about essential endgame principles, such as king activity, pawn promotion, and mating patterns.
06
Practice regularly: Dedicate time to playing actual games to improve your chess skills. Engage in both against computer opponents and human opponents of varying skill levels. Learn from your mistakes and continually seek to enhance your understanding of the game.
